Specifications
Mounting Type: Through Hole
Features: --
Ratings: --
Applications: High Frequency, Switching
Lead Spacing: 0.886" (22.50mm)
Termination: PC Pins
Height - Seated (Max): 0.807" (20.50mm)
Size / Dimension: 1.043" L x 0.378" W (26.50mm x 9.60mm)
Package / Case: Radial
Series: QXP
Operating Temperature: -40°C ~ 105°C
Dielectric Material: Polypropylene (PP), Metallized
Voltage Rating - DC: 800V
Voltage Rating - AC: 250V
Tolerance: ±5%
Capacitance: 0.15µF
Part Status: Active
